Essential Functions:
- Compile and validate credit package data including financial spreads cash flow collateral valuation appraisals and supporting due diligence.
- Independently analyze and underwrite commercial credit requests across C&I CRE and business banking segments.
- Evaluate borrower performance and repayment capacity including cash flow adequacy collateral support industry conditions and management quality.
- Identify primary risks mitigants and policy exceptions.
- Partner with Relationship Managers to ensure deal structuring is sound and credit packages are complete
- Prepare concise risk-focused credit summaries and presentations of creditworthiness including clear strengths weaknesses and key drivers.
- Present and support recommendations to approval authorities and committees including joint presentations with the Relationship Manager when needed.
- Manage a pipeline of credits across varying size and complexity with consistent turnaround and disciplined execution.
- Ensure requests are processed in accordance with bank policy banking regulations and applicable laws.
- Support modernization initiatives in credit workflow tools and help scale best practices across the team.
- Senior most level may function as a lead and be responsible for second level approvals.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
